In the recent article by our townsman, Dr. Hans H. Neumann, "PicaSymptom or Vestigial Instinct?" (Pediatrics, 46:441) the concept of vestigial instinct is used as part of the basis for discounting emotional deprivation as one of the most significant factors leading to pica in this country. Dr. Neumann's otherwise fascinating report does not define adequately what he means by instinct, nor does he use the word pica in its usual sense. He admirably describes how a mother in West Africa introduces her infant to a piece of wood for chewing.
